Alcohol Test Services

Alcohol testing in Spring Creek, Oklahoma is a process used to measure the amount of alcohol in an individual's body typically through breath, blood, or urine samples. It is important in determining intoxication levels and compliance with legal or workplace regulations.

Learn More

Alcohol Testing is used in many settings

  • Workplace safety compliance
  • Road and traffic safety checkpoints
  • Medical diagnostics
  • Rehabilitation centers
  • Legal and court-ordered settings

Common Methods of Alcohol Testing

  • Breathalyzer
  • Blood test
  • Urine test
  • Saliva test
  • Hair test

Breathalyzer - Used for immediate intoxication checks.

Blood test - Provides detailed BAC levels.

Urine test - Detects alcohol consumption over time.

Saliva test - Quick detection for recent use.

Hair test - Long-term alcohol consumption record.

DOT Drug Testing Services

DOT drug testing refers to tests mandated by the Department of Transportation, for employees involved in safety-sensitive positions to ensure a drug-free environment and adherence to federal regulations.

Learn More

Who is Required to Take DOT Drug Tests?

  • Commercial vehicle drivers
  • Aviation employees
  • Pipeline workers
  • Maritime employees
  • Transit operators
  • Railroad employees

What Drugs Are Tested For

  • Cocaine
  • Opiates
  • Marijuana
  • Amphetamines
  • PCP

Occupational Health Test Services

Occupational health testing in , Spring Creek, Oklahoma serves as a safeguard for workforce health, ensuring employees are fit for their designated roles. Tests include a range of health assessments conducted to verify health standards, compliance with occupational safety regulations, and adaptation to work environments, maintaining both health and productivity.

Learn More

Purpose of Occupational Health Testing

  • Health and safety compliance
  • Identifying workplace hazards
  • Preventing work-related injuries
  • Ensuring employee wellbeing
  • Assisting in worker rehabilitation
  • Reducing workplace absenteeism

Common Types of Occupational Health Tests

  • Fitness for duty exams: Evaluates physical and mental readiness for work.
  • Respirator Fit Testing: Ensures proper respirator use for respiratory protection.
  • Pulmonary Function Tests (PFT's): Assesses lung function for specific roles.
  • Tuberculosis (TB): Screens for infectious risks in the workplace.
  • Vision: Tests sight quality for roles requiring precision.
  • Audiometric: Checks hearing capabilities for audio-sensitive tasks.
